#236906 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#236906 is composed of 13.7% red, 41.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 102.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 21.8%. #236906 color hex could be obtained by blending #46d20c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#236906 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#236906 has RGB values of R:35, G:105,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2320646.

Shades and Tints of #236906
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c01 is the darkest color, while #fafff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#236906
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363a35 is the less saturated color, while #216d02 is the most saturated one.
